@charset "UTF-8";.contents{width:800px;margin-left:auto;margin-right:auto}@media only screen and (max-width:1081px){.contents{width:90%}}.mapfooter{display:block}#searchSp{display:none}@media only screen and (max-width:1081px){#searchSp{display:none}}.mapWrap{width:90%;aspect-ratio:25/13!important;height:auto;position:relative;margin:80px auto 120px;overflow:hidden;-webkit-box-shadow:0px 5px 30px 0px rgba(17,17,17,0.1);box-shadow:0px 5px 30px 0px rgba(17,17,17,0.1)}@media only screen and (max-width:1081px){.mapWrap{height:40vh;margin-bottom:80px}}.mapWrap .btn_saigai{position:absolute}@media only screen and (max-width:1081px){.mapWrap .btn_saigai{width:50px;right:190px;bottom:auto;top:60px}}@media only screen and (max-width:1081px){.mapWrap .btn_saigai.open{top:60px;right:0}}.mapWrap .leaflet-control-layers-expanded .leaflet-control-layers-list{width:200px}.mapWrap .leaflet-control-layers-expanded .leaflet-control-layers-toggle{position:absolute;top:0;left:0}.mapWrap .leaflet-control-layers.leaflet-control{position:absolute!important;left:10px;top:10px;z-index:1000}.mapWrap .leaflet-right{right:auto}.mapWrap .btn_re{display:none}.mapWrap #bonrei{top:70px}.mapWrap .btn_bonrei{position:absolute;top:0;left:0}.mapWrap #saigai{position:absolute;height:calc(70vh - 60px);top:60px;right:-270px}@media only screen and (max-width:1081px){.mapWrap #saigai{width:200px;right:0}}.mapWrap #saigai.open{right:0}@media only screen and (max-width:1081px){.mapWrap #saigai.open{right:-200px}}.mapWrap .leaflet-control-attribution{position:absolute!important;bottom:0!important;left:0;width:100%!important;float:none}.mapWrap .leaflet-bottom .leaflet-control-scale{width:100%}.mapWrap .leaflet-bottom{bottom:0;height:100%;width:100%;float:none}.mapWrap .leaflet-bottom .leaflet-control-zoom{position:absolute;float:none;top:calc(50% - 70px)}.mapWrap .leaflet-popup.leaflet-zoom-animated{display:none!important}.mapWrap .mapCenterIcon{position:absolute;margin:auto;top:0;bottom:0;left:0;right:0;width:40px;height:40px;z-index:10000}.mapWrap .mapCenterIcon:after{content:"";display:block;background-repeat:no-repeat;background-size:40px;width:40px;height:40px;position:absolute;top:0;left:0;background-image:url("data:image/svg+xml;charset=utf8,%3Csvg%20xmlns%3D%22http%3A%2F%2Fwww.w3.org%2F2000%2Fsvg%22%20viewBox%3D%220%200%20448%20512%22%3E%3Cpath%20d%3D%22M256%2080c0-17.7-14.3-32-32-32s-32%2014.3-32%2032l0%20144L48%20224c-17.7%200-32%2014.3-32%2032s14.3%2032%2032%2032l144%200%200%20144c0%2017.7%2014.3%2032%2032%2032s32-14.3%2032-32l0-144%20144%200c17.7%200%2032-14.3%2032-32s-14.3-32-32-32l-144%200%200-144z%22%2F%3E%3C%2Fsvg%3E")}.mapWrap.tablet{height:40vh}#mapid{width:100%;height:100%;z-index:1;position:relative!important}.acf-form-submit,.btn{position:relative;text-align:center;margin-bottom:60px}.acf-form-submit a,.acf-form-submit button,.acf-form-submit input,.btn a,.btn button,.btn input{display:block;max-width:400px;width:100%;margin-left:auto;margin-right:auto;background:#FFDA26 url(../img/iconArw.png) 92% center/8px no-repeat;text-align:center;font-size:1.8rem;font-weight:700;font-family:"Noto Sans JP",sans-serif;height:90px;line-height:90px;position:relative;cursor:pointer;border:1px solid #111;width:100%;border-radius:0;border:none}@media only screen and (max-width:1081px){.acf-form-submit a,.acf-form-submit button,.acf-form-submit input,.btn a,.btn button,.btn input{max-width:100%}}.acf-form-submit.btnPdf a,.acf-form-submit.btnPdf button,.btn.btnPdf a,.btn.btnPdf button{background:#111 url(../img/iconArwW.png) 92% center/8px no-repeat;color:#fff}.formWrap{margin-bottom:60px;overflow:hidden}.formWrap .acf-field-682ec55a59d52 .acf-label{display:none}.formWrap .acf-fields>.acf-field{border:none;padding:0}.formWrap .acf-label{margin-bottom:0}.formWrap .acf-label label{margin-bottom:0}.formWrap .acf-form-fields{margin-bottom:60px;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ap}.formWrap .acf-form-submit{display:none}.formWrap .acf-form-submit.show{display:block;margin-top:20px}.formWrap .acf-field-68395dce038fd,.formWrap .acf-field-68395df1038fe{display:none}.formWrap .acf-field-682eb6e563756{margin-right:40px}.formWrap .acf-field-682eb6e563756,.formWrap .acf-field-682eb6f863757{display:-webkit-box;display:-ms-flexbox;display:flex;gap:16px;-webkit-box-align:center;-ms-flex-align:center;align-items:center;margin-bottom:40px;width:calc((100% - 40px) / 2)}.formWrap .acf-field-682eb6e563756 .acf-input,.formWrap .acf-field-682eb6f863757 .acf-input{-webkit-box-flex:1;-ms-flex:1;flex:1}.formWrap .acf-field-682eb71b63758{margin-right:16px}.formWrap .acf-field-682eb72863759{margin-right:40px}.formWrap .acf-field-682eb71b63758,.formWrap .acf-field-682eb72863759{max-width:120px;position:relative}.formWrap .acf-field-682eb71b63758 .acf-label,.formWrap .acf-field-682eb72863759 .acf-label{position:absolute;height:100%;width:36px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;background:#ccc;top:0;right:0;border-top-right-radius:6px;border-bottom-right-radius:6px;z-index:2}.formWrap .acf-field-682eb73d6375a{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:16px;-webkit-box-flex:1;-ms-flex:1;flex:1}.formWrap .acf-field-682eb73d6375a .acf-input{-webkit-box-flex:1;-ms-flex:1;flex:1}.formWrap .acf-field-682ec55a59d52{width:100%}.formWrap .acf-field-682ec55a59d52 h2{margin-top:60px;background:#111;color:#fff;text-align:center;padding:14px 0;position:relative;margin-bottom:50px;font-size:1.8rem}.formWrap .acf-field-682ec55a59d52 h2:after{top:100%;left:50%;border:solid transparent;content:" ";height:0;width:0;position:absolute;pointer-events:none;border-color:rgba(255,242,20,0);border-top-color:#111;border-width:8px;margin-left:-8px}.formWrap .acf-field-682ec9d6d4b9f{width:100%;margin-bottom:20px}.formWrap .acf-field-682eb7476375b,.formWrap .acf-field-682eb7676375c,.formWrap .acf-field-682eb7706375d,.formWrap .acf-field-682eb77d6375e,.formWrap .acf-field-682eb7c963761{width:100%;margin-bottom:40px}.formWrap .acf-field-682eb7476375b .acf-label,.formWrap .acf-field-682eb7676375c .acf-label,.formWrap .acf-field-682eb7706375d .acf-label,.formWrap .acf-field-682eb77d6375e .acf-label,.formWrap .acf-field-682eb7c963761 .acf-label{margin-bottom:10px}.formWrap .acf-field-682eb7926375f{width:100%;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:16px;margin-bottom:20px}.formWrap .acf-field-682eb7926375f .acf-input{-webkit-box-flex:1;-ms-flex:1;flex:1}.formWrap .acf-field-682eb7b763760{display:-webkit-box;display:-ms-flexbox;display:flex;gap:0 16px;-webkit-box-align:center;-ms-flex-align:center;align-items:center;margin-bottom:20px}.formWrap .acf-field-682eb7b763760 .acf-input-wrap{border-radius:6px;overflow:hidden}.formWrap .acf-field-682eb7b763760 .acf-input{position:relative;overflow:hidden}.formWrap .acf-field-682eb7b763760 .acf-input input{border-radius:6px}.formWrap .acf-field-682eb7b763760 .acf-input .acf-input-append{position:absolute;height:100%;width:36px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;background:#ccc;top:0;right:0;border-top-right-radius:6px!important;border-bottom-right-radius:6px;z-index:2;border:none;font-weight:700}.formWrap .acf-field-682ecdb89ebfe{margin-bottom:40px;width:100%}.formWrap .acf-field-682ecdb89ebfe label{font-family:"Noto Sans JP",sans-serif;position:relative;font-size:1.4rem;margin-left:1em;text-indent:-1em;font-weight:500}.formWrap .acf-field-682ecdb89ebfe label:before{content:"※"}.formWrap input,.formWrap textarea{font-family:"Noto Sans JP",sans-serif;border-radius:6px;border:1px solid #ccc;min-height:60px;background:#f5f5f5;font-size:1.6rem}.formWrap .acf-form-submit,.formWrap .btn{position:relative;text-align:center;margin-bottom:60px}.formWrap .acf-form-submit a,.formWrap .acf-form-submit button,.formWrap .acf-form-submit input,.formWrap .btn a,.formWrap .btn button,.formWrap .btn input{display:block;max-width:400px;width:100%;margin-left:auto;margin-right:auto;background:#FFDA26 url(../img/iconArw.png) 92% center/8px no-repeat;text-align:center;font-size:1.8rem;font-weight:700;font-family:"Noto Sans JP",sans-serif;height:90px;line-height:90px;position:relative;cursor:pointer;border:1px solid #111;width:100%;border-radius:0;border:none}@media only screen and (max-width:1081px){.formWrap .acf-form-submit a,.formWrap .acf-form-submit button,.formWrap .acf-form-submit input,.formWrap .btn a,.formWrap .btn button,.formWrap .btn input{max-width:100%}}.formWrap .acf-form-submit.btnPdf a,.formWrap .acf-form-submit.btnPdf button,.formWrap .btn.btnPdf a,.formWrap .btn.btnPdf button{background:#111 url(../img/iconArwW.png) 92% center/8px no-repeat;color:#fff}.manabiWrap{margin-top:60px}.manabiWrap h2{font-size:3.2rem;margin-bottom:40px}.manabiWrap .manabiContents{background:#f7f7f7;padding:40px;margin-bottom:120px}.manabiWrap .manabiContents .schoolInfo{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-ms-flex-wrap:wrap;flex-wrap:wrap;gap:20px;padding-bottom:40px;margin-bottom:40px;border-bottom:1px solid #ddd}.manabiWrap .manabiContents .schoolInfo .area{background:#111;padding:4px 20px;display:inline-block;font-weight:700;color:#fff}.manabiWrap .manabiContents .schoolInfo .ido{width:100%}.manabiWrap .manabiContents .schoolInfo .name{font-weight:700;font-size:1.8rem}.manabiWrap .manabiContents dl dt{font-weight:700;margin-bottom:10px}.manabiWrap .manabiContents dl dd{background:#fff;padding:20px}.manabiWrap .manabiContents dl dd:not(:last-of-type){margin-bottom:60px}#searchBox{display:none}.manabiList li a{font-weight:700;font-size:1.8rem;display:block}.manabiList li:not(:last-of-type){margin-bottom:20px;padding-bottom:20px;border-bottom:1px dotted #ccc}@media print{.contents{-webkit-print-color-adjust:exact}html{font:50.5%/1.6 ArialMT;width:90%;margin:0 auto;padding:0}body{margin:0;padding:0}#searchBoxSP,#searchSp,.btn,footer.mapfooter,header{display:none}.acf-field{-webkit-column-break-inside:avoid;-moz-column-break-inside:avoid;break-inside:avoid}#bonrei,.formWrap .acf-form-submit a,.formWrap .acf-form-submit button,.formWrap .acf-form-submit input,.formWrap .btn a,.formWrap .btn button,.formWrap .btn input,.leaflet-control-attribution.leaflet-control,.leaflet-control-layers.leaflet-control,.leaflet-control-zoom.leaflet-bar.leaflet-control,.mapWrap .mapCenterIcon{display:none}.formWrap input,.formWrap textarea{min-height:40px}.formWrap .acf-field-682ec55a59d52 h2{margin-top:20px;background:#111!important;color:#fff;text-align:center;padding:6px 0;position:relative;margin-bottom:10px;font-size:1.6rem}.formWrap .acf-field-682ec55a59d52 h2:after{top:100%;left:50%;border:solid transparent;content:" ";height:0;width:0;position:absolute;pointer-events:none;border-color:rgba(255,242,20,0);border-top-color:#111;border-width:8px;margin-left:-8px}.leaflet-container .leaflet-control-attribution,.leaflet-container .leaflet-control-scale{font-size:10px}.mapWrap{margin-top:0;margin-bottom:40px}.contents{width:86%;margin-left:auto;margin-right:auto}.formWrap{margin-bottom:0;width:80%;margin-left:auto;margin-right:auto;display:block}.formWrap .acf-field-682eb6e563756,.formWrap .acf-field-682eb6f863757,.formWrap .acf-field-682eb7476375b,.formWrap .acf-field-682eb7676375c,.formWrap .acf-field-682eb7706375d,.formWrap .acf-field-682eb77d6375e,.formWrap .acf-field-682eb7c963761,.formWrap .acf-form-fields{margin-bottom:10px}}
/*# sourceMappingURL=main.css.map */